Add 50/28 and 1/21
1st number: 1 22/28, 2nd number: 1/21
50/28 + 1/21 is 11/6.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 28 and 21 is 84
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 84 - For the 1st fraction, since 28 × 3 = 84,
50/28 = 50 × 3/28 × 3 = 150/84 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 21 × 4 = 84,
1/21 = 1 × 4/21 × 4 = 4/84 - Add the two like fractions:
150/84 + 4/84 = 150 + 4/84 = 154/84 - 154/84 simplified gives 11/6
- So, 50/28 + 1/21 = 11/6
